The all-new 2020 Honda Accord is set to debut in Malaysia soon and the premium executive sedan is open for booking at all 100 Honda dealerships nationwide. The 10th Generation Accord, for the first time for a Japanese automaker in the D-segment, will sport a 1.5-litre VTEC turbocharged engine.

Since its debut in 1976, the Accord has risen to fame globally for its premium appeal and styling. In Malaysia specifically, the premium sedan has sold more than 84,100 units to date since its arrival on these shores in 2001. Continuing to raise the standards of the D-segment, the 9th Generation Accord secured its top market position in 2013 as it sold in excess of 32,500 units. Following that in 2017, Honda introduced the Next Generation Advanced Safety feature—Honda Sensing in the 9th Generation Accord, further raising the stakes of premium features in its class.

The headline feature of the 2020 Accord is the new, enhanced 1.5-litre VTEC turbocharged engine, a first for the flagship model. Power output tops 198bhp (201PS) and maximum torque is 260Nm. What’s interesting is that it’s the same mill that you will find on the Civic and CR-V, except that power output and torque have been bumped up.

They say there’s no replacement for displacement, but guess what? This new turbocharged lump offers better performance than the 2.4-litre engine in the previous generation Accord. With Malaysia’s displacement-based road tax structure, this will sit well with the local folks.

The 10th Gen Accord continues to feature a fastback design and now comes with sharper LED headlights and taillights. It now has a wider, more aggressive disposition with a lower hood as well as lower and longer roofline. That aside, it sports a Twin Tailpipe Chrome Finisher and a set of unique 18-inch alloy wheels with a resonator.

Like its predecessor, the new Accord comes with a full suite of Honda Sensing safety technology including Driver Cruising Aid: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C), Low Speed Follow (LSF), Auto High-Beam (AHB); Frontal Collision Deterrence: Forward Collision Warning (FCW), Collision Mitigation Braking System (CMBS); and Side Collision Deterrence: Lane Keep Assist System (LKAS), Road Departure Mitigation (RDM), Lane Departure Warning (LDW).

Additionally, the vehicle packs Smart Parking Assist System with Brake Assist (Rear), Multi View Camera System (360-degree camera) and Honda LaneWatch for drivers’ convenience and safety. All variants will come with standard safety features such as six airbags, Vehicle Stability Assist (VSA), Anti-lock Braking System (ABS), Electronic Brake Distribution (EBD), Emergency Stop Signal (ESS), Hill Start Assist (HSA), front and rear parking sensors together with a multi-angle rearview camera.
